The North America Negative Pressure Wound Therapy (NPWT) Pumps market has seen significant growth due to the increasing prevalence of chronic wounds and the rising demand for advanced wound care therapies. NPWT pumps are used to assist in the healing of chronic and acute wounds by applying controlled negative pressure to the wound area. Hospitals are one of the largest segments within the NPWT pumps market, owing to the high volume of patients requiring wound care. NPWT pumps in hospital settings are widely used for treating complex wounds, including surgical wounds, diabetic ulcers, and pressure ulcers. The growing number of surgeries and the increasing prevalence of chronic conditions like diabetes and obesity are major factors contributing to the demand for NPWT pumps in hospitals. Hospitals offer comprehensive wound care facilities, which include the use of NPWT pumps for both inpatient and outpatient care, thus fostering market growth. Moreover, hospitals have the necessary infrastructure and expertise to operate advanced medical devices, enhancing the adoption of NPWT pumps for managing various types of wounds efficiently.

The North American NPWT pumps market is witnessing several key trends that are shaping its growth trajectory. One of the most prominent trends is the increasing adoption of portable and wearable NPWT devices. These devices offer patients the flexibility to manage their wound care at home or on the go, improving patient compliance and comfort. This trend is particularly relevant in the context of home healthcare, as patients with chronic wounds or recovering from surgery prefer the convenience of receiving therapy outside of traditional healthcare settings. As a result, manufacturers are focusing on developing compact, lightweight, and user-friendly NPWT pumps that offer enhanced mobility and ease of use for both patients and healthcare providers.
Another significant trend is the ongoing advancements in NPWT pump technology, which are improving the efficiency and effectiveness of wound healing. Manufacturers are increasingly incorporating features such as adjustable pressure settings, better suction control, and more intuitive interfaces into NPWT devices. These innovations are not only enhancing the performance of NPWT pumps but also making them more accessible and easier to use for both clinicians and patients. Additionally, the integration of real-time monitoring systems that allow healthcare providers to track the progress of wound healing remotely is gaining traction. This trend is particularly important in reducing healthcare costs, improving patient outcomes, and increasing the overall efficiency of wound care management.

1. What is NPWT therapy and how does it work?
NPWT, or Negative Pressure Wound Therapy, is a treatment that uses controlled negative pressure to promote wound healing by removing exudate and improving blood flow to the wound area. It helps to accelerate the healing of chronic or acute wounds.
2. What types of wounds are treated using NPWT pumps?
NPWT pumps are typically used to treat chronic wounds, surgical wounds, pressure ulcers, diabetic ulcers, and traumatic wounds, among others, by applying negative pressure to accelerate the healing process.
3. How do portable NPWT pumps differ from traditional pumps?
Portable NPWT pumps are designed for home use, offering patients greater mobility and comfort compared to traditional hospital-based devices. They are lightweight, compact, and easy to use, allowing patients to manage their wound care independently.
4. Are NPWT pumps suitable for home healthcare?
Yes, NPWT pumps are increasingly used in home healthcare settings. Portable models enable patients to receive treatment at home, improving convenience, reducing hospital stays, and promoting faster recovery.
